2025.03.11(tue)
お仕事ID:51967
営業組織支援SaaSにおけるフルスタック開発(Typescript)
NEW
リモート可
服装自由
土日祝休み
高単価
85万円~100万円 / 月額報酬
- 最寄駅
- 渋谷駅
- 勤務時間
- 140~180 h/月
- 職種
- システムエンジニア
- 雇用形態
- 業務委託
求人募集要項
仕事内容
- 仕事内容
- 営業組織向けのセールスイネブルメントSaaSを提供している会社にて、フルスタックでご担当いただきます。
開発プロセスの最適化からアーキテクチャの設計、開発実務にいたるまで、技術面での進化をリーダーシップを持って牽引いただくポジションです。
《業務内容》
・開発業務全般の技術や仕様部分でのリード(仕様調整、設計、実装、テスト、保守運用)
・新機能の設計~詳細設計
・既存設計のテストやリファクタリング
・各種コードレビューやテストコード作成、内部品質向上
・開発チームの課題を発見と改善
・プロダクトallでの横断プロジェクトの推進
・プロダクト毎、またはプロダクトallのアーキテクチャの検討
《課題》
・事業拡大に伴うデータ量の増加への対応
- 大量のデータに対してユーザーが自由に構築できるReadクエリの速度改善
- 頻繁な分析・書き込みのワークロードに耐えうるDB基盤の構築
・既存コードの技術負債解消
- ユニットテストの拡充
- フロントエンドの複雑さの解消、リファクタリング
《技術スタック》
・フロントエンド
- TypeScript, Next.js, TailwindCSS, Ant Design, Apollo Client, monaco-editor
・バックエンド
- TypeScript, Node.js, Nexus, Prisma, PostgreSQL, BigQuery
・インフラ
- AWS
・その他
- Turborepo, PEG.js, Zod, Auth0, Docker, GitHub, Bugsnag, Notion, Figma, Redash,Posthog, Fivetran, dbt
・補足
- フロントエンド/バックエンドともにTypeScriptで統一
- Prisma, GraphQL, Zodを用いた型安全な開発
- Turborepoによるモノレポ・モジュラーモノリス
- パッケージ数は30。ドメインロジックをモジュール化し、DI・Pureな関数に保つなど、テスタブルな構成で開発
応募の対象者
- 必須スキル
- ・5年以上のWebアプリケーション開発経験
要件定義~実装まで一気通貫でご担当いただきます。
Webアプリケーションにおける代表的な脆弱性(XSS, SQLインジェクション等)とその対策についての理解
・フルスタック開発のご経験をお持ちの方
フロントエンドについては主要なコンポーネントライブラリ(React, Vue, Angular, Svelte等)の内、いずれかのご経験
DB設計、チューニングについて(正規化、BTREEインデックス、パーティショニング等)の基本的な理解
SPA, SSRの仕組みについての基本的な理解
・アジャイル開発経験をお持ちの方
・基本的なアルゴリズム設計能力をお持ちの方
- 歓迎スキル
- ・TypeScriptを用いた開発経験
・複雑かつ大規模なアプリケーションの設計/開発経験
・開発チームをリードした経験
・toB SaaSの開発経験
・ELT, BIなどの分野の知識/経験
・アンチパターン等を理解し、主体的に設計やリファクタリングを行なった経験
- ツール・
言語 - TypeScript、Node.js、Next.js、PostgreSQL
担当工程
- 担当工程
- 要件定義、基本設計(外部設計)、詳細設計(内部設計)、開発(コーディング/プログラミング)、テスト、リリース、運用・保守
勤務条件
雇用形態
- 業務委託
給与
85万円~100万円 / 月額報酬
勤務地
東京都渋谷区
- 最寄駅
- 渋谷駅
勤務時間
140~180 h/月
- 残業時間
- なし
急成長中のスタートアップ企業でスピード感ある開発に携わることができます。
2024年10月1日に会員機能(マイページ)をリリースいたしました。
会員にご登録されていない方は、「未登録の方はこちら」のボタンからご登録をお願いいたします。
※2024年9月30日時点で当社から求人情報の提供を受けている方、及び求人選考中の方にはメールにて会員IDおよび初期パスワードをお送りしておりますのでご確認ください。
メールが届いていない場合は、お手数ですが当社担当者宛てにご連絡ください。
×